A specialist travel company in the UK is seeking a Product Executive to support the development of educational travel products. This full-time role will involve working with a passionate team and offers a salary of £30k along with hybrid working arrangements.
The ideal candidate has experience in a travel product role, excellent organizational skills, and is proficient in Office365.
Benefits include extensive holiday entitlements and personal development opportunities.

How to prepare for a job interview at C&M Travel Recruitment
✨Know Your Travel Products
Make sure you brush up on the latest trends in educational travel products. Familiarise yourself with what the company offers and think about how your experience aligns with their current offerings. This will show your genuine interest and help you stand out.
✨Showcase Your Organisational Skills
As a Product Executive, you'll need to demonstrate excellent organisational skills. Prepare examples from your past roles where you've successfully managed projects or coordinated teams. Be ready to discuss how you prioritise tasks and handle multiple responsibilities.
✨Get Comfortable with Office365
Since proficiency in Office365 is a must, make sure you're well-versed in its applications. Practice using tools like Excel for data analysis or PowerPoint for presentations. You might even want to prepare a quick demo of how you would use these tools in your role.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the company's vision for educational travel products and how they measure success. This not only shows your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the company culture aligns with your values. Plus, it keeps the conversation flowing!
